Liquid Cooling Approaches for Bitcoin S23 Miners
Optimizing output and operational time of your Crypto Series 23 miners is critical , particularly in hot environments. Conventional air refrigeration can be inadequate to effectively dissipate heat , leading to diminished hash rates and potential malfunction. Hydraulic cooling systems offer a superior alternative, providing better thermal control and permitting for higher computational capacity.
